George's to Somerset will see defending champion Rudy Bailey attempting to record victory number five in the event.
Last year with Sinclair Simons as crew for the first time, Bailey beat the fleet home from Somerset to St. George's in his boat Temptation in 2:16:27 to win the Edward Cross Trophy. Now the duo will line up in St. George's Harbour on Monday in hopes of duplicating that performance.
This year's fleet will be slightly smaller than a year ago with 25 expected at the start.
Among the regulars favoured to challenge Bailey are former champion Stevie Dickinson ( Kitty Hawk ) who was second last year, Gladwin Lambert ( Melody ), Howard Simmons ( My New Mary ) and David Wall ( Tango ).
